If you ever wanted to be a rock star when you were growing up, then this summer you may want to check out Camp Bestival 2017! Each year the festi-holiday sets a theme for the weekend and it’s fun to see the imaginative dressing up that goes into it from festival dwellers. The 2017 theme is now announced – It’s Pop Stars and Rock Stars!
This is great news – it means I can easily get the kids a suitable outfit that they can also wear for their daily clothes afterwards – thankfully ripped jeans and T shirts with the band’s name on them are always cool, and for me – well maybe I will go a little ‘Alice Cooper’ this year – or perhaps hubby and I can paint our faces like KISS!
This year sees the festival’s tenth event, as always curated by Rob and Josie da Bank. It takes place from 27th – 30th July 2017 at Lulworth Castle, Dorset and we can’t wait! The Friday night headliner is Mark Ronson and there are also sets by Holly Johnson and the coolest 90s girl band, All Saints. The Saturday night headliner that has just been announced is Madness! The event will also host the UK festival exclusive of School of Rock, the musical which we are very excited about as we couldn’t get to London to see it in the West End.
